"""Message handling functionality for WeCom Bot MCP Server.""" # Import built-in modules from typing import Annotated from typing import Any from typing import Literal # Import third-party modules from loguru import logger from mcp.server.fastmcp import Context from notify_bridge import NotifyBridge from pydantic import Field # Import local modules from wecom_bot_mcp_server.app import mcp from wecom_bot_mcp_server.bot_config import get_bot_registry from wecom_bot_mcp_server.bot_config import get_multi_bot_instructions from wecom_bot_mcp_server.bot_config import list_available_bots from wecom_bot_mcp_server.errors import ErrorCode from wecom_bot_mcp_server.errors import WeComError from wecom_bot_mcp_server.utils import encode_text # Type alias for message types MessageType = Literal["markdown", "markdown_v2"] # Constants MESSAGE_HISTORY_KEY = "history://messages" MARKDOWN_CAPABILITIES_RESOURCE_KEY = "wecom://markdown-capabilities" MULTI_BOT_INSTRUCTIONS_KEY = "wecom://multi-bot-instructions" # Message history storage message_history: list[dict[str, str]] = [] @mcp.resource(MESSAGE_HISTORY_KEY) def get_message_history_resource() -> str: """Resource endpoint to access message history. Returns: str: Formatted message history """ return get_formatted_message_history() @mcp.resource(MULTI_BOT_INSTRUCTIONS_KEY) def get_multi_bot_instructions_resource() -> str: """Resource endpoint providing multi-bot usage instructions. Returns: str: Instructions for using multiple bots """ return get_multi_bot_instructions() def get_formatted_message_history() -> str: """Get formatted message history. Returns: str: Formatted message history as markdown """ if not message_history: return "No message history available." formatted_history = "# Message History\n\n" for idx, msg in enumerate(message_history, 1): role = msg.get("role", "unknown") content = msg.get("content", "") formatted_history += f"## {idx}. {role.capitalize()}\n\n{content}\n\n---\n\n" return formatted_history @mcp.resource(MARKDOWN_CAPABILITIES_RESOURCE_KEY) def get_markdown_capabilities_resource() -> str: """Resource endpoint describing WeCom markdown capabilities. This can be used by MCP clients or models to decide which message type to use based on the desired formatting (tables, images, colors, mentions, etc.). """ return ( "# WeCom Markdown Capabilities\n\n" "## Message Type Selection Guide\n" "**IMPORTANT**: Choose the correct msg_type based on your content:\n\n" "### Use `markdown` when:\n" "- Content contains user mentions using `<@userid>` syntax\n" '- Content uses font colors: `<font color="info|comment|warning">text</font>`\n' "- You need to @mention specific users in the message\n\n" "### Use `markdown_v2` when:\n" "- Content contains tables (using | columns |)\n" "- Content contains ordered/unordered lists\n" "- Content contains embedded images: `![alt](url)`\n" "- Content contains URLs with underscores (markdown_v2 preserves them)\n" "- Content uses multi-level quotes (>>, >>>)\n" "- Content uses horizontal rules (---)\n" "- Default choice for general formatted content without mentions\n\n" "## Common to both markdown and markdown_v2\n" "- Headers (# to ######)\n" "- Bold (**text**) and italic (*text*)\n" "- Links: [text](url)\n" "- Inline code: `code`\n" "- Block quotes: > quote\n\n" "## Only markdown\n" '- Font colors: <font color="info|comment|warning">text</font>\n' "- Mentions: <@userid> - Use this to @mention users!\n\n" "## Only markdown_v2\n" "- Tables (using | columns | and separator rows)\n" "- Lists (ordered and unordered)\n" "- Multi-level quotes (>>, >>>)\n" "- Images embedded with ![alt](url), e.g. ![chart](https://example.com/chart.png)\n" "- Horizontal rules (---)\n" "- Preserves underscores in URLs\n" "- Auto-escapes slashes in URLs\n\n" "## Image sending recommendations\n" "- If the main content is a standalone image file or screenshot, " "send it with the send_wecom_image tool (msg_type=image), passing the local file path as `image_path`.\n" "- If the image is just an illustration inside a larger report, " "use markdown_v2 and embed it with ![alt](url).\n\n" "## File sending recommendations\n" "- Use the send_wecom_file tool when sending non-image files such as " "reports, logs, or archives.\n" "- Local file paths are acceptable for `file_path`; this server will upload the file to WeCom " "via NotifyBridge and recipients will see it as an attached file message.\n" ) @mcp.prompt(title="WeCom Message Guidelines") def wecom_message_guidelines() -> str: """High-level guidelines for planning WeCom messages. This prompt explains how to choose between `markdown` and `markdown_v2` message types, when to call the image/file tools, and how to use multiple bots. """ base_guidelines = ( "When sending messages to WeCom via this MCP server, follow these rules:\n\n" "## Message Type Selection (IMPORTANT)\n" "This server supports two markdown message types. Choose based on content:\n\n" "### Use `markdown` when:\n" "- **Content contains @mentions**: If you need to mention users with `<@userid>` syntax, " "you MUST use `markdown` type. The `<@userid>` syntax ONLY works in `markdown` type.\n" '- **Content uses font colors**: `<font color="info|comment|warning">text</font>`\n' "- Example: `<@john_doe> Please review this report` → use `markdown`\n\n" "### Use `markdown_v2` when:\n" "- Content contains **tables** (using | columns |)\n" "- Content contains **lists** (ordered or unordered)\n" "- Content contains **embedded images**: `![alt](url)`\n" "- Content contains **URLs with underscores** (markdown_v2 preserves them)\n" "- Content uses **multi-level quotes** (>>, >>>)\n" "- **Default choice** for general formatted content without @mentions\n\n" "## Quick Decision Rule\n" "**If the content has `<@userid>` patterns → use `markdown`**\n" "**Otherwise → use `markdown_v2`**\n\n" "## Other Guidelines\n" "- For plain text without special formatting, use `markdown_v2`.\n" "- When you have an image URL that should appear inside the text, embed it inline " "using markdown_v2 image syntax: ![description](image_url).\n" "- You may reference local filesystem images (e.g. C:\\path\\to\\image.png or /tmp/image.png); " "this server will attempt to upload them via the WeCom file API and rewrite the markdown to use a " "remote URL when possible. If upload fails, the original path is kept as a fallback.\n" "- If the main content is an image file (local path or URL), " "call the `send_wecom_image` tool instead of embedding it in markdown.\n" "- If the user asks to send a non-image file (reports, logs, archives), " "call the `send_wecom_file` tool with the local file path.\n" "- It is safe to pass local file/image paths to these tools; this server will call NotifyBridge " "to upload the file to WeCom so recipients can access it.\n" "- URLs must be preserved exactly; do not change underscores or other " "characters inside URLs.\n\n" ) # Add multi-bot instructions multi_bot_info = get_multi_bot_instructions() return base_guidelines + multi_bot_info async def send_message( content: str, msg_type: str = "markdown_v2", mentioned_list: list[str] | None = None, mentioned_mobile_list: list[str] | None = None, bot_id: str | None = None, ctx: Context | None = None, ) -> dict[str, str]: """Send message to WeCom.
